Transaction 21a04e656b211ebcbc9c93e32462ed94c84832544e7466c84676eef5231e89bf
1 Input
1 Output
-
21a04e656b211ebcbc9c93e32462ed94c84832544e7466c84676eef5231e89bf:0
- value
- 269761386
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 003b777c1e00b7232af7d1547d09ef09db68d5e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 112EEpe5PAYJAY31hN7afgq9WsJRgcuTXH